Brittany Day | Finding Her Passion in Personal Training

After pursuing tourism, having Covid completely change her plans, and later studying psychology at university, Brittany Day still hadn't found the career that truly excited her. It wasn't until someone casually suggested she'd make a great personal trainer that everything clicked.

Today, Brittany is an award-recognised personal trainer and is helping people of all ages build confidence, strength and healthier lifestyles.
